使用this.$router.push进行页面上router-view组件的路由替换;实现点击底部导航栏页面切换功能;
1, 页面实现(html模版中) 在vue-router中, 我们看到它定义了两个标签<router-link> 和<router-view>来对应点击和显示部分。<router-link> 就是定义页面中点击的部分,<router-view> 定义显示部分,就是点击后,区配的内容显示在什么地方。所以 <router-link> 还有一个非常重要的属性 to,定义点击之后,要到哪里去...
在使用router-view之前,需要先安装并配置vue-router。我们可以通过npm或者yarn来安装vue-router,命令分别为: ``` npm install vue-router ``` 或 ``` yarn add vue-router ``` 2. 创建并配置路由 在项目中创建router文件夹,并在其中创建index.js文件,用于配置路由。在index.js文件中,我们需要导入vue和vue-...
使用router-view非常简单,只需要在Vue实例的模板中添加<router-view>标签即可。当路由匹配到对应的路径时,router-view会自动渲染匹配到的组件。 下面我们来具体讲解一下router-view的使用方法。 1. 安装Vue Router 我们需要安装Vue Router。可以使用npm或者yarn进行安装。 2. 配置路由 在Vue项目的根目录下,新建一个...
注意 router-view 只需要一个 Props, name 你不能使用 router-view 要将 Props 传递给渲染的组件,您需要使用 props 路线选项 。const router = VueRouter.createRouter({ { path: '/user/:id', component: app.component('user'), // Pass the `id` route parameter as the `userId` prop...
解锁Vue.js 路由奥秘:router-view 的深入解析与实战应用 在 Vue.js 的开发过程中,实现单页面应用的路由管理是非常重要的一环。Vue Router 是 Vue.js 官方的路由管理器,与 Vue.js 核心深度集成,可以方便地构建…
个人笔记---Vue中多个router-view应用,单个<router-view/>和多个<router-view/>的区别,单个<router-view/>只是一个区域的变化,不需要设置name属性,在设
router-view是Vue Router提供的一个组件,用来显示匹配当前路由的组件内容。在使用router-view时,需要在Vue组件中的模板中添加标签,这样就可以让Vue Router根据当前路由的路径来动态渲染匹配的组件内容。 下面是一个简单的示例: <template> <router-view></router-view> </template> 复制代码 在上面的示例中,会根...
在Vue.js中,绑定多个router-view的实现方式可以通过嵌套路由和命名视图来完成。以下是详细的描述和实现步骤: 1、嵌套路由 嵌套路由是指在父组件中嵌套子组件的路由视图。通过这种方式,可以在不同的层级展示不同的内容。 // router/index.js import Vue from 'vue...
1.router-viewrouter-view是渲染视图的: 主要是构建 SPA (单页应用) 时, 方便渲染你指定路由对应的组件。你可以 router-view 当做是一个容器,它渲染的组件是你使用 vue-router 指定的;路由配置完成后, 就要使…